Due to globalization, market dynamics, and customer interest variations, the manufacturing industry is facing high computational challenges. To overcome these problems, the issue of mass customization (MC) has received substantial attention in the manufacturing industry. The efficiency and effectiveness of mass customization are measured by the capability of producing customized products without sacrificing product quality, cost, delivery time, variety, and volume. It is known that manufacturing strategies are the basic enabling factors for the effectiveness and efficiency of mass customization. However, most studies did not clearly define the impact level of each enabling factor on each of the mass customization capabilities. The main objective of this research was to identify the level of impact of manufacturing strategies on each mass customization capability. A fuzzy Delphi questionnaire designed with a seven-point scale has been applied to obtain expert opinions on the impact level of each enabling factor. The opinions were combined for each enabling factor by considering the importance level of each expert and aggregated by using an algorithm. Finally, the level of impact of each enabling factor on each mass customization capability was clearly identified. The result shows that even if the level of impact varies, all the manufacturing strategies have their own impacts on product cost, variety, quality, volume, and delivery time called mass customization capabilities, which are the basic factors to maximize the effectiveness and efficiency of mass customization.
